noch nicht ganz gelöst:* bei cmdalias

Begonnen von rasti, 11 Februar 2020, 20:43:42

Vorheriges Thema - Nächstes Thema

rasti

Ich habs aufgegeben.

Bzw. anders gelöst, einfach einen Bestätigungsbutton in Tablet UI unter den Regler.

Geht und tut was es soll. Danke trotzdem an Otto  :D

Code und Screenshot anbei

Viele Grüße
Ralf

<li data-row="2" data-col="6" data-sizex="1" data-sizey="3" class="semitransparent">
<header><font size="+1">Bad</font></header>
<table width="100%">
                <tr>     <td> Ist:</td>

                             <td>
<div data-type="label" style="font-size: 200% "
data-device="HM_3CFD66" data-get="measured-temp" data-unit="%B0C%0A" data-fix="1"
data-limits="[10,18,23]" data-colors='["#0000ff","#00ff00","#ff0000"]' >
</div>
                          </td>
                          </tr>
                            <tr><td> Ventil:</td>
<td> <div data-type="label" style="font-size: 200% "
data-device="HM_3CFD66" data-get="actuator" data-unit="%" data-fix="1"
data-limits='[0,33,66]' data-colors='["skyblue","darkorange","orangered"]'>
</div>
</td>
</TR>
</table>
<hr>Reglereinstellung

   <BR><BR>

<div data-type="thermostat"
data-device="HM_3CFD66_Clima" data-get="desired-temp"
                                                         data-set="desired-temp" 
                                                      data-valve="ValvePosition"
                                  data-min="0" data-max="30" data-step="0.5"

data-fgColor="darkorange"
data-height="100px"
data-width="100px">
</div>Confirm
<div data-type="image" data-url="/../images/default/confirm.png"  data-size="25%" onclick="setFhemStatus('set HM_3CFD66_Clima burstXmit ; window.location.reload();')"></div>

<HR>
<div data-type="multistatebutton"
                                                                             data-device="HM_3CFD66_Clima"
                                                                             data-get="controlMode"
                                                                             data-get-on='["auto","manual"]'
data-set='["controlMode manual","controlMode auto"]'                                                data-icons='["oa-sani_heating_automatic","oa-sani_heating_manual"]'                                                 data-colors='["darkgreen","darkblue"]'
data-background-icon="fa-square"
data-background-color="grey"
>
</div>

<div data-type="multistatebutton"
                                                                             data-device="HM_3CFD66"
                                                                        data-get="R-btnLock" data-get-on='["on","off"]'
data-set='["regSet btnLock off","regSet btnLock on"]'
data-icons='["oa-secur_locked","oa-secur_open"]'
data-colors='["darkred","darkblue"]'
data-background-icon="fa-square"
data-background-color="grey"
>
</div>
<div data-type="symbol" data-device="HM_3CFD66" data-get="batteryLevel"
     data-icons='["oa-measure_battery_100","oa-measure_battery_100","oa-measure_battery_75","oa-measure_battery_50","oa-measure_battery_25","oa-measure_battery_0"]'
     data-get-on='["3","3\\.[0-9]","2\\.[789]","2\\.[456]","2\\.[123]","((2\\.0)|([01]\\.[0-9]))"]'
     data-on-colors='["#0CFB0C","#0CFB0C","#42BC0A","#F5FF10","#FB5909","#E50005"]'>
</div>
<div data-type="pagebutton" data-url="temperatur-bad.html" class="cell" data-icon="fa-area-chart" class="cell"></div>
</li>


MadMax-FHEM

#16
Du kannst/hättest auch burst beim HKT setzen können, dann reagiert er auch sofort auf Änderung von u.a. desired-temp.

EDIT: https://wiki.fhem.de/wiki/HomeMatic#Burst bzw. https://wiki.fhem.de/wiki/HM-CC-RT-DN_Funk-Heizk%C3%B6rperthermostat#Burst-Modus und dann: So aktiviert man den burst-Betrieb am HM-CC-RT-DN

Bzgl. Batterieverbrauch kann/konnte ich nicht wirklich mehr Verbrauch feststellen... Hängt aber auch von generellem Funkverkehr ab... (inkl. "Nachbarschaft")

Hab ich so bei einigen meiner HKTs...

Gruß, Joachim
FHEM PI3B+ Bullseye: HM-CFG-USB, 40x HM, ZWave-USB, 13x ZWave, EnOcean-PI, 15x EnOcean, HUE/deCONZ, CO2, ESP-Multisensor, Shelly, alexa-fhem, ...
FHEM PI2 Buster: HM-CFG-USB, 25x HM, ZWave-USB, 4x ZWave, EnOcean-PI, 3x EnOcean, Shelly, ha-bridge, ...
FHEM PI3 Buster (Test)

rasti

Zitat von: MadMax-FHEM am 18 Februar 2020, 22:06:02
Du kannst/hättest auch burst beim HKT setzen können, dann reagiert er auch sofort auf Änderung von desired-temp.


Hallo Joachim,

klingt äusserst vielversprechend.....kannst du das mal genauer erklären ?

Schöne Grüße
Ralf

MadMax-FHEM

#18
Hallo Ralf,

steht doch in den Links... ;)

Einfach das burst Regisert setzen und gut...
...bzw. halt noch das Attribut.

also so wie im 2ten Link inkl. angegebene "Stelle"...

Gruß, Joachim
FHEM PI3B+ Bullseye: HM-CFG-USB, 40x HM, ZWave-USB, 13x ZWave, EnOcean-PI, 15x EnOcean, HUE/deCONZ, CO2, ESP-Multisensor, Shelly, alexa-fhem, ...
FHEM PI2 Buster: HM-CFG-USB, 25x HM, ZWave-USB, 4x ZWave, EnOcean-PI, 3x EnOcean, Shelly, ha-bridge, ...
FHEM PI3 Buster (Test)

rasti

Redest du von dem R-burstRx Register ? Die sind bei allen THermostaten gesetzt.
Aber nur langes Warten oder eben ein burstXmit setzt den neuen Sollwert.

MadMax-FHEM

FHEM PI3B+ Bullseye: HM-CFG-USB, 40x HM, ZWave-USB, 13x ZWave, EnOcean-PI, 15x EnOcean, HUE/deCONZ, CO2, ESP-Multisensor, Shelly, alexa-fhem, ...
FHEM PI2 Buster: HM-CFG-USB, 25x HM, ZWave-USB, 4x ZWave, EnOcean-PI, 3x EnOcean, Shelly, ha-bridge, ...
FHEM PI3 Buster (Test)

rasti

Zitat von: MadMax-FHEM am 18 Februar 2020, 22:34:40
Attribut gesetzt!?


Oh manomanomann..... so viele vergeudete Stunden und dann diese einfache Lösung  >:(

Also vielen vielen Dank Joachim  :)

Ich hab das dämliche Attribut gefunden. :) :)
Das Attribut heisst "burstAccess" und muss auf "1_auto" gesetzt werden.

Funktioniert natürlich  :o


MadMax-FHEM

Tja... ;)

Oft so...

Dann noch viel Spaß, Joachim
FHEM PI3B+ Bullseye: HM-CFG-USB, 40x HM, ZWave-USB, 13x ZWave, EnOcean-PI, 15x EnOcean, HUE/deCONZ, CO2, ESP-Multisensor, Shelly, alexa-fhem, ...
FHEM PI2 Buster: HM-CFG-USB, 25x HM, ZWave-USB, 4x ZWave, EnOcean-PI, 3x EnOcean, Shelly, ha-bridge, ...
FHEM PI3 Buster (Test)